# pyinotifyd
|
||||
A daemon to monitor filesystems events with inotify on Linux and run tasks like filesystem operations (copy, move or delete), a shell commands or custom async python methods.
|
||||
It is possible to schedule tasks with a delay, delayed tasks can be cancelled again in case a certain event occurs. A useful example would be to run tasks only if a file has not changed within a certain amount of time.
|
||||
A daemon for monitoring filesystem events with inotify on Linux and run tasks like filesystem operations (copy, move or delete), a shell command or custom async python methods.
|
||||
|
||||
It is possible to schedule tasks with a delay, which can then be canceled again in case a canceling event occurs. A useful example for this is to run tasks only if a file has not changed within a certain amount of time.
|
||||
|
||||
pyinotifyd offers great flexibility through its dev-op configuration approach, which enables you to do almost anything you want.

pyinotifyd has different schedulers to schedule tasks with an optional delay. The advantages of using a scheduler are consistent logging and the possibility to cancel delayed tasks. Furthermore, schedulers have the ability to differentiate between files and directories.
|
||||
|
||||
### TaskScheduler
|
||||
Schedule a custom python method *job* with an optional *delay* in seconds. Skip scheduling of tasks for files and/or directories according to *files* and *dirs* arguments. If there already is a scheduled task, re-schedule it with *delay*. Use *logname* in log messages.
|
||||
Schedule a custom python method *job* with an optional *delay* in seconds. Skip scheduling of tasks for files and/or directories according to *files* and *dirs* arguments. If there already is a scheduled task, re-schedule it with *delay*. Use *logname* in log messages. All additional modules, functions and variables that are defined in the config file and are needed within the *job*, need to be passed as dictionary to the TaskManager through *global_vars*. If you want to limit the scheduler to run only one job at a time, set *singlejob* to True.
|
||||
All arguments except for *job* are optional.

### ShellScheduler
|
||||
Schedule a shell command *cmd*. Replace **{maskname}**, **{pathname}** and **{src_pathname}** in *cmd* with the actual values of occuring events. This scheduler is based on TaskScheduler and has the same optional arguments.
|
||||
```python
|
||||
# Please note that **{src_pathname}** is only present for IN_MOVED_TO events and only in the case where the IN_MOVED_FROM events are watched too.
|
||||
# Please note that **{src_pathname}** is only present for IN_MOVED_TO events and only
|
||||
# in the case where the IN_MOVED_FROM events are watched too.
|
||||
# If it is not present, the command line argument will be an empty string.
